Can you play football in the rain?

Association football generally plays on through rain, although matches can be abandoned if the pitch becomes severely waterlogged or there is lightning in the area, with the latter case being more for the protection of spectators within the metal stands surrounding stadiums.

Do soccer players play in the rain?

As an outdoor sport soccer is played in less than ideal conditions including falling drizzle, rain, sleet and snow. However, the presence of visible lightning or audible thunder – at the soccer fields and at the time of play (with or without falling rain) creates a safety concern and necessitates a soccer cancellation.

Does rain affect soccer?

Wet Fields Heavy rainstorms greatly affect a soccer pitch, especially if it’s natural turf. Substantial rainfall can create puddles, muddy areas, and sinkholes on soccer fields. These change the game in a few ways. Soccer players often complain that the ball moves too fast when turf is wet.

How do you catch the rain in football?

If possible, pick plays involving short passes or hand-offs to prevent rain from falling on the ball mid-play. Tuck the ball into your body with your forearm and bicep as you run. This is a technique used by the pros to increase their grip while sprinting or during play in wet weather. Keep your fingers over the laces.

How much rain is considered heavy for a college football game?

The American Meteorological Society defines “heavy” rain between 0.3 and two inches per hour (the only thing higher is “violent” rainfall). A single inch of rain during a college football game would be heavy rain for 3-4 hours straight.

How much rain did it rain on Heinz Field in 2007?

Two rounds of thunderstorms delayed the game’s start by an hour and drenched the metro area with around 5 inches of rain. The 2007 “Muddy Night Football” – A storm system dumped 1.5 inches of rain on Pittsburgh’s Heinz Field just before a Steelers vs. Dolphins game.

Why do soccer teams water the field before every game?

Some like playing on more wet playing surfaces, so the ball moves faster, and to have a more fluent game. These teams water the field before every game and during halftime.
